DEV Community

Command Line Interface

CLI is a text-based user interface used to interact with a computer's operating system or software by typing commands into a terminal.

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Why CLI over MCP?

Why CLI over MCP?

9
Comments 2
2 min read
One Open Source Project a Day (No. 54): Warp - The AI-Native Rust Terminal

One Open Source Project a Day (No. 54): Warp - The AI-Native Rust Terminal

Comments
4 min read
I Built a Universal CLI Scaffolding Tool — Scaffy v1.0.1 is Live

I Built a Universal CLI Scaffolding Tool — Scaffy v1.0.1 is Live

Comments
2 min read
How to Use AI CLI Tools: Claude Code, Codex, and Gemini CLI

How to Use AI CLI Tools: Claude Code, Codex, and Gemini CLI

Comments
5 min read
I built a changelog generator that works on any repo — no conventional commits needed

I built a changelog generator that works on any repo — no conventional commits needed

Comments
2 min read
I Got Tired of Switching Between curl and Postman — So I Built My Own CLI

I Got Tired of Switching Between curl and Postman — So I Built My Own CLI

1
Comments
3 min read
OverTheWire: Bandit Level 2

OverTheWire: Bandit Level 2

3
Comments
1 min read
Stop Boring Code Reviews: 2 CLI Tools That Actually Make You a Better Developer

Stop Boring Code Reviews: 2 CLI Tools That Actually Make You a Better Developer

Comments
4 min read
Authenticating CLI Tools With Descope

Authenticating CLI Tools With Descope

1
Comments
8 min read
I built a TOML-based task runner in Rust

I built a TOML-based task runner in Rust

1
Comments
1 min read
Using Gemini CLI with Vertex AI (Without Worrying About Your Data)

Using Gemini CLI with Vertex AI (Without Worrying About Your Data)

Comments
3 min read
I Built a Zero-Config Project Health Analyzer — Just Run npx dev-lens in Any Repo

I Built a Zero-Config Project Health Analyzer — Just Run npx dev-lens in Any Repo

Comments
2 min read
I Mass-Produced Spaghetti Code for Three Months Before I Figured Out the Actual Problem

I Mass-Produced Spaghetti Code for Three Months Before I Figured Out the Actual Problem

Comments
4 min read
I lost 3 hours of work to Claude Code, so I built an undo button for AI-assisted coding

I lost 3 hours of work to Claude Code, so I built an undo button for AI-assisted coding

Comments
3 min read
Spawning a PTY in Rust: How broll Captures Your Terminal Without You Noticing

Spawning a PTY in Rust: How broll Captures Your Terminal Without You Noticing

1
Comments
6 min read
👋 Sign in for the ability to sort posts by relevant, latest, or top.